Features and description

Occupying the entire first floor of an attractive mid-Victorian semi, this larger-than-average flat 794 sq. ft delivers period charm with contemporary flair, high ceilings and gorgeous natural light, all moments from two Zone 4 stations. The flat’s high ceilings and large windows create an airy sense of space throughout, while the well-proportioned layout offers versatility and comfort, whether you're hosting friends in the spacious living area , separate kitchen or enjoying a quiet moment in one of the two peaceful double bedrooms.

Key Features
• Bay-fronted reception – 16’5 sq. ft reception room with bespoke alcove shelving, original coving and a south-facing five-bay window framing leafy views.
• Stylish galley kitchen – cream cabinets, granite-effect worktops, metro tiling and integrated appliances (gas hob, electric oven, extractor); bathed in sunlight from breakfast onwards.
• Principal bedroom – king-size friendly 13’2 sq. ft bathed in calm treetop views with ample space for freestanding or fitted storage.
• Versatile second bedroom / study / nursery – 12’6 sq. ft ample space for freestanding or fitted storage, neutral décor.
• Smart three-piece bathroom – shower-over-bath, heated towel rail, crisp white tilework.
• Turn-key finishes – double glazing, gas central heating, light oak-effect flooring, freshly decorated in muted tones.
• Ample storage – walk-in utility cupboard plus additional hallway and bedroom cabinetry

Outside & Access
• Large, secluded south-facing communal garden – perfect for summer BBQs or quiet reading.
• Dual access – traditional front door via communal hallway and private external fire-escape staircase (handy for bikes, bulky deliveries and extra peace of mind).
• Free on-street parking
Perfectly positioned just a 4-minute walk (0.2 miles) from Selhurst Station, offering direct services to London Victoria in around 26 minutes, along with connections to Clapham Junction, Balham, and Sutton. Norwood Junction is also nearby (10-minute walk / 0.5 miles), providing fast trains to London Bridge (approx. 12 minutes), London Overground services to Canada Water, Shoreditch, and Dalston, plus Thameslink routes to Farringdon and St Pancras.
You’ll also find independent shops, local cafés, and a choice of green spaces close by — offering the perfect blend of urban convenience and relaxed living.
